Elway, Favre lead list of MVPs of ’90s

By Joel Buchsbaum, Contributing editor
As published in print Oct. 25, 1999

John Elway
John Elway

We asked our panel of insiders whom they considered the Most Valuable Player of the 1990s. As one might expect, quarterbacks dominated the list. All responses were made anonymously.

1. QB John Elway, Broncos — "Once he got out of Dan Reeves’ offense, he played the best football of his career." … "Nobody had more talent, and he peaked in this decade." … "What has happened this year should tell you just how much he meant to that team."

2. QB Brett Favre, Packers — "Of all the players (GM) Ron Wolf brought in, he was most responsible for bringing the Pack back." … "The new John Elway." … "How many games has he missed? How many games has he played? How many games has he brought the Pack back in?" … "Where would they be without him?" … "Getting Favre from the Falcons for a first-round pick was one of (the greatest), if not the greatest, trades in pro football history."

3. QB Troy Aikman, Cowboys — "Has the Super Bowl rings to prove it." … "Not the improviser that Elway or Favre were but did exactly what was asked of him and played his best in the playoffs and Super Bowl."

4. QB Steve Young, 49ers — "Took over where Joe Montana left off." … "Has any quarterback ever been more efficient? He has been in the zone for a decade. That is unheard of."
